    "content": "Personally, I am inspired by people like Mekatilili wa Menza, a heroine from the Coast who fought against colonialism. I also recall Koitalel arap Samoei of Nandi and Waiyaki wa Hinga. Such are the people we should celebrate in Kenya and teach our children about. I say so because our children are not taught about these heroes. They are only taught about people like Christopher Columbus and Mark Apollo. They are taught about conquerors from the West who came to conquer us, but no one is being taught about Waiyaki wa Hinga, Mekatilili wa Menza, Kenneth Matiba and Charles Rubia. We need to teach children to know the people who made Kenya to be; the people who went out of their way to fight for a better country, fight against colonialists, imperialism and the dictatorship of President Moi. They paid with their dear lives by doing that. To me, this Motion seeks to celebrate a great legend. We should support all the others, so that their history does not get lost.
